Turns out to be a very simple patch - include itests in the modules list in the
top level pom.
Verified that the artifacts generated by mvn package are the same with and
without the patch.
Also, a mvn import into IntelliJ works a lot better now.
I'm not sure this needs hive-qa to run. We could change some of the commands
which are run by HiveQA after this goes in (separate builds for hive and itests
not required).
